"With my ministry of light, part of what I do is work on the California Alliance For Arts Education"
About this Quote
The specific intent is practical: to name a concrete affiliation (the California Alliance for Arts Education) and tether it to a larger purpose. But the subtext is about credibility and reinvention. Actors are routinely asked to justify their seriousness outside the screen, especially women of Kirkland’s generation, who have been expected to age with gratitude and quietness. "Ministry" pushes back. It implies authority, stewardship, even a calling, while "light" softens it into something non-denominational and culturally palatable. It’s spiritual without being churchy, earnest without being sectarian.
Context matters here: arts education in California has been chronically vulnerable to budget politics, treated as enrichment rather than infrastructure. By framing advocacy as "what I do", Kirkland normalizes activism as labor, not hobby. The line works because it fuses two currencies celebrities trade in: visibility and meaning. It’s a bid to be seen not only as an entertainer, but as a citizen with a cause and a cosmology.
